NATURE OF WORK
This is professional work performing administrative functions with respect to laboratory accreditation, quality assurance and safety programs for the laboratory system of a state agency. You will perform quality assurance duties to monitor the laboratory’s system compliance, develop quality assurance manuals and documents, conduct or coordinate quality assurance audits and resolve technical deficiencies. Work also includes administering the laboratory proficiency testing program, participating in and support training and safety programs, conducting safety inspections and audits and resolving deficiencies, and assisting in the development, presentation and coordination of standardized training. Work may involve testifying in court and at hearings as an expert witness.

Minimum Requirements
Three years of professional laboratory experience in a chemical, physical, biological or forensic discipline and a bachelor’s degree in chemistry, biology, or forensic sciences or closely related field, which included or was supplemented by 16 credit hours in chemistry or microbiology.
Graduate work in chemical, biological or forensic sciences or a closely related field may be substituted for experience up to a maximum of one year.
Conditions of Employment
Certain positions with the Pennsylvania State Police require that two of the three years of professional laboratory experience occurred in a forensic laboratory.
Certain positions in this class may require a valid Pennsylvania driver’s license.
